The large-cap segment, as represented by the BSE 100 index, has experienced a modest decline over recent sessions, reflecting a cautious market mood. While some heavyweight stocks such as IndusInd Bank have shown resilience, others like Tube Investments have faced pressure, underscoring a divergence between defensive and cyclical sectors.



Overview of Large-Cap Index Movement


The BSE 100 large-cap index recorded a decline of 0.59% on the day, continuing a subdued trend with a 0.13% fall over the past five trading days. This performance indicates a cautious stance among investors amid mixed economic signals and sectoral rotations. The breadth of the market within this segment was notably skewed, with 25 stocks advancing against 74 declining, resulting in an advance-decline ratio of 0.34x. Such a ratio highlights the prevailing pressure on a majority of large-cap constituents.



Heavyweight Movers and Sectoral Trends


Among the large-cap stocks, IndusInd Bank emerged as a relative outperformer, posting a return of 2.06%. This performance suggests investor preference for select financial stocks amid broader market uncertainty. Conversely, Tube Investments registered a return of -4.19%, marking it as one of the weakest performers in the segment. The divergence between these stocks reflects the contrasting fortunes of defensive versus cyclical sectors within the large-cap universe.
